02 THE PROBLEM
Marine growth begins accumulating whenever a hull sits in the water. Left unmanaged, that layer changes how a vessel moves, how often it needs service, and what it may carry between waterways.
A fouled hull creates resistance through the water. That can mean higher fuel or energy use, reduced speed and range, and more frequent cleaning or haul-out decisions for owners and operators.
Hull fouling can carry organisms from one marina or waterway to another. Increased drag also raises the energy required to move a vessel, adding avoidable fuel use and emissions.
Cleaning and inspection are still largely manual, inconsistent, and difficult to document. Basilisk is building the robotic layer for scheduled, measurable, and increasingly autonomous hull care.
03 OUR SOLUTION
Basilisk checks the hull, cleans the areas that need attention, and keeps a record of the work—all without turning routine maintenance into a major event.
Examine the hull for buildup, structural damage such as cracks, holes, and dents, as well as paint damage and signs of corrosion.
Choose the areas to clean and plan an efficient route around the hull so the robot can work methodically and avoid missed sections.
Designed for both metal and fiberglass boats, the robot attaches securely to the hull being serviced and removes buildup with controlled passes.
Save cleaning coverage, images, notes, and areas of concern to build a useful history for future maintenance decisions.
